About the Author
Gay Hendricks, author of non-fiction bestsellers such as Conscious Loving and The Big Leap, took a big leap of his own by beginning a new career at age 60 writing mystery novels. First, he launched a series featuring the Tibetan Buddhist detective, Tenzing Norbu, and now after six Tenzing mysteries (and a television show in development) Hendricks now brings us a new series with a Victorian-Edwardian-era detective, Sir Errol Hyde.
